Graduate Physical Sciences Degrees at Columbia University

The table below lists every degree level available for physical sciences at Columbia University, along with how many graduates complete each level annually.

Degree Level Annual Graduates
Bachelor’s 108
Master’s 62
Doctoral 48
Professional Certificate 67

Graduate Physical Sciences Majors at Columbia University

This physical sciences area of study at Columbia University breaks down into these majors. Follow a link for the major’s detailed rankings and outcomes:

Major Annual Graduates
Physics 75
Geological and Earth Sciences/Geosciences 73
Chemistry 55
Astronomy and Astrophysics 39
Materials Sciences 27
Physical Sciences, Other 16

Columbia University Graduate Tuition and Fees

$84,925 Average Tuition and Fees (In-State)

The full-time graduate tuition and fees are shown below.

In State Out of State
Tuition $81,888 $81,888
Fees $3,037 $3,037

Master’s Student Diversity

Among recent graduates, 63% of physical sciences master’s degrees went to men and 37% went to women.

Columbia University gender breakdown of Physical Sciences Master's degree grads The majority of physical sciences master’s degree graduates at Columbia University are Non-Resident Alien. Approximately 53% of graduates fell into this category.

The following table and chart show the ethnic background for students who recently graduated from Columbia University in the City of New York with a master’s in physical sciences.

Ethnic diversity of Physical Sciences majors at Columbia University in the City of New York
Ethnic Background Number of Students
Asian 4
Black or African American 0
Hispanic or Latino 3
White 20
Non-Resident Aliens 33
Other Races 2
